タグ

2014年10月3日のブックマーク (13件)

  • 開発環境のデータをできるだけ本番に近づける - クックパッド開発者ブログ

    こんにちは。技術部の吉川です。 今回はクックパッドの開発環境構成、特に開発用データベースの構成についてご紹介します。 開発環境の構成 クックパッドのシステム環境は以下のようなフェイズに分かれています。 ※ これはcookpad.comの構成で、サブシステムや個別のサービスはその規模や特性に応じて構成が異なります。 development 開発者が実際に開発を行う環境です。クックパッドでは仮想環境は用いず、手元のマシンでRailsアプリケーションを動かして開発を行っています。 データベースはローカルではなく、開発者全体で共通の開発用データベースに接続しています。 test 手元でテストを実行する場合は、ローカルマシンのデータベースを利用します。CI(rrrspec)などの場合も同様で、テスト実行サーバーのデータベースが利用されます。 staging stagingといえば準番環境として、

    開発環境のデータをできるだけ本番に近づける - クックパッド開発者ブログ
    taguch1
    taguch1 2014/10/03
  • プログラマとして30年以上の経験から得た教訓 | POSTD

    私は、プログラマとして30年以上仕事をしてきた中で、学んだことがあります。そのいくつかを以下にご紹介します。もっと挙げることもできますよ。 実物を見せないと、顧客の希望は分からない。 このことは最初の仕事で学びました。顧客は、実物を見るまでは、何が当に必要なのかがよく分かりません。言葉で長々と説明するよりも、機能検証のためのプロトタイプを提示する方が確実に役立ちます。 十分な時間があれば、あらゆるセキュリティは破られる。 現代社会において、セキュリティを保つことは信じられないほどの難題となっています。プログラマは常に完璧を求められますが、ハッカーは1回でもハッキングができれば成功なのです。 セキュリティが破られた場合、事前にその状況に備えた対策を講じているかどうかで結果が変わってくる。 最終的にセキュリティが破られることを想定する場合、その時に起こることに備えて対策を立てておく必要があり

    プログラマとして30年以上の経験から得た教訓 | POSTD
    taguch1
    taguch1 2014/10/03
  • “月額2980円で3MbpsのLTEが使い放題”の衝撃――NTTぷららに聞く「定額無制限プラン」の狙い

    ―― 定額無制限プランが話題を集めていますが、それはいったん置いておいて、まずは、なぜぷららがMVNOをやっているのかについて、聞かせてください。 原田氏 その話は定額無制限プランを始めた理由にもつながっていきます。ご存じのとおり、ぷららはISPで固定を中心にやってきました。一方で最近では、外出先でもインターネットを使いたいというニーズが高まっています。いつでもどこまでもインターネットを使っていただきたいというのが、MVNOを始めた最初のきっかけです。 また、ドコモさんだけだったMNOに、auやソフトバンクも入ってきて(接続料が公開され)、MVNOの認知度も上がってきました。加えて、SIMフリー端末のラインアップも多様化してきています。こうした環境の変化も大きかったですね。 では、ぷららとしてNTTグループの中でどうすみ分けていくのか。ここに、定額無制限プランを開始した理由の1つがあります

    “月額2980円で3MbpsのLTEが使い放題”の衝撃――NTTぷららに聞く「定額無制限プラン」の狙い
    taguch1
    taguch1 2014/10/03
    サイト周りと契約周りの運用を見直したほうがいいと思う。個人情報を預けるには相当不安。
  • やっぱりエンジニア系転職エージェントはクソだな

    エンジニア転職サイトに登録して転職エージェントと打ち合わせしたけど、 打ち合わせ前のメールの時点で、履歴書と職務経歴書をメールで添付してくださいとか、 Wordファイルのアンケートを送りつけて回答してくださいとか、 諸々ITリテラシーを疑いたくなるようなことやっといて、 いざ打ち合わせになったらそんな条件の求人は無いですと返して来やがった。 ちなみに提示した条件は、 週休4日/6h年収400万リモート開発/自宅作業 その他の質問は、 転職後のアフターは、入社してから2週間後ぐらいにメールで伺ってそれ以降は何もしていない。 ジョブ・ディスクリプションは、明確にヒアリングも出来てない。 結局エージェントなんてエンジニアを一山幾らしか考えていないんじゃないの? それよりもお前らそんなに真面目に会社で仕事してんの?

    やっぱりエンジニア系転職エージェントはクソだな
    taguch1
    taguch1 2014/10/03
    狙った会社にgithubアカウントを送れば
  • CodeIQについてのお知らせ

    2018年4月25日をもちまして、 『CodeIQ』のプログラミング腕試しサービス、年収確約スカウトサービスは、 ITエンジニアのための年収確約スカウトサービス『moffers by CodeIQ』https://moffers.jp/ へ一化いたしました。 これまで多くのITエンジニアの方に『CodeIQ』をご利用いただきまして、 改めて心より深く御礼申し上げます。 また、エンジニアのためのWebマガジン「CodeIQ MAGAZINE」は、 リクナビNEXTジャーナル( https://next.rikunabi.com/journal/ )に一部の記事の移行を予定しております。 今後は『moffers by CodeIQ』にて、 ITエンジニアの皆様のより良い転職をサポートするために、より一層努めてまいりますので、 引き続きご愛顧のほど何卒よろしくお願い申し上げます。 また、Cod

    CodeIQについてのお知らせ
    taguch1
    taguch1 2014/10/03
  • DeNAを退職し宗教を立ち上げ書籍を出版しアメリカで起業します

    いつも当ブログをご覧になっていただきありがとうございます。 最近いろんなコトがあったので、わたくしの近況をお知らせします。 株式会社ディー・エヌ・エーの退職 株式会社ディー・エヌ・エーでの最終出社日2014/9/30を無事終えることができました。 ゲーム制作部門に在籍し、国内・海外向けソーシャルゲームのサーバ・クライアントの開発、またはその支援に従事してきました。多くの優秀な同僚と知り合えたこと、中規模チームでの開発、新卒・中途採用面接などは、とても大きな糧となっています。私の力及ばず、大ヒットゲームを世に出すことが出来なかったことは心残りです。 一緒に働いた同僚・取引先のみなさま、引き続きよろしくお願いいたします! 宗教の立ち上げ 宗教Virtual Religionを立ち上げました。 Virtual Religionですが、現時点では「空飛ぶスパゲッティーモンスター教」のようなフェイク

    DeNAを退職し宗教を立ち上げ書籍を出版しアメリカで起業します
    taguch1
    taguch1 2014/10/03
  • sprintf を最大10倍以上高速化するプリプロセッサ「qrintf」を作った

    最近H2OというHTTPサーバを書いているのですが、プロファイルを取ってみるとsprintfが結構な時間をっていて不満に感じていました。実際、sprintfは数値や文字列をフォーマットするのに十徳ナイフ的に便利なので、HTTPサーバに限らず良く使われる(そしてCPU時間を消費しがちな)関数です。 では、sprintfを最適化すれば、様々なプログラムが より高速に動作するようになるのではないでしょうか。ということで作ったのが、qrintfです。 qrintfは、Cプリプロセッサのラッパーとしてソースコードに含まれるsprintfの呼出フォーマットを解析し、フォーマットにあわせたコードに書き換えることで、sprintfを高速化します。 たとえば、以下のようなIPv4アドレスを文字列化するコード片を sprintf( buf, "%d.%d.%d.%d", (addr >> 24) & 0xf

    taguch1
    taguch1 2014/10/03
  • Sqwiggleが最初の課金ユーザを獲得した3つの方法 | POSTD

    3 Ways We Acquired Our First Paying Customer by Matt Boyd Sqwiggleの共同設業者で、熱心なリモートワーカー。他には執筆やドラム演奏も。コーヒー愛飲者。 @mattboyd Sqwiggleは、リモートワークチームのための常時"繋ぎっぱなし"ビデオチャットアプリ。PCのカメラより定期的に作業の様子が共有され、呼び出しや同意の必要がなく、実際に話しかけるように1クリックですぐに会話が始めることができる。 今回のブログ記事では、いつもとはちょっと違う話題を取り上げましょう。今日は、弊社が(2013年6月3日までに)経験したことを時系列で振り返り、簡単にまとめたいと思います。その狙いは、弊社の銀行口座に初めて55ドルが振り込まれるまでの詳しい経緯を皆さんにご紹介することです。 あの日は実にエキサイティングな1日でした。 1. まずは自

    taguch1
    taguch1 2014/10/03
  • 「高い授業料だった」武雄市発自治体通販脱退の三島市長 - 高圧洗浄機で北へ進め

    楽天Amazonにつづく通販第3極」「地域所得の向上」をうたい文句に、佐賀県武雄市が始めた自治体運営型通販サイトは、開始から3年目を迎えようとしています。 2014年10月1日にはYahoo!ショッピングへの全面移転し、サイト名も変更されています。 平素より「JAPANsg」をご利用いただき、誠にありがとうございます。 この度、「JAPANsg」はサイト名称を「自治体特選ストア」へ変更し、Yahoo!ショッピングへ移転しました。 http://japan-sg.jp/ この自治体通販サイトは、開始から約3年間で、名前を変え、場所を変え、現在ではまったく別物になっています。 2011年11月 F&B良品TAKEO オープン Facebook上に通販サイト開設 (時期不明) F&B良品 から FB良品 へいつのまにか名称変更 2012年12月 Facebook から Makeshop にサ

    「高い授業料だった」武雄市発自治体通販脱退の三島市長 - 高圧洗浄機で北へ進め
    taguch1
    taguch1 2014/10/03
  • GitHub - piqnt/svgexport: SVG to PNG/JPEG command-line tool and Node.js module

    You signed in with another tab or window. Reload to refresh your session. You signed out in another tab or window. Reload to refresh your session. You switched accounts on another tab or window. Reload to refresh your session. Dismiss alert

    GitHub - piqnt/svgexport: SVG to PNG/JPEG command-line tool and Node.js module
    taguch1
    taguch1 2014/10/03
  • LDRがなくなるとのことで俺用フィードリーダー作った - mizchi's blog

    2日で作った。昨日から無職なので手が空いてたのもある。 こんなの mizchi/my-feed-reader 概要 nodeでクローラ100行、サーバー40行、クライアント400行ぐらい。テストはない。cssもない。 認証とかなくて、ローカルで動かすの前提。LDRのexport.xml(opml)を読み込む。詳しくはREADMEで。 jksaでフィードを移動する。sで飛ばした時に未読フラグつけてる。oでバックグラウンドで開く。 大事なことなんだけど、マウス操作は一切対応してない。 データベースは使ってない。サーバーでインメモリで抱えてる分だけ降ってきて、既読管理は最後に読んだフィードの更新日時をlocalStorageで持ってて新規フィードもらうたびに比較してる。雑な設計。 技術的な話 Koa, React, Generatorとか自分が使いたい技術を適当に使った。 Reactで雑に作るの

    LDRがなくなるとのことで俺用フィードリーダー作った - mizchi's blog
    taguch1
    taguch1 2014/10/03
  • GitHub - fastladder/fastladder: Fastladder Open Source [Forked]

    You signed in with another tab or window. Reload to refresh your session. You signed out in another tab or window. Reload to refresh your session. You switched accounts on another tab or window. Reload to refresh your session. Dismiss alert

    GitHub - fastladder/fastladder: Fastladder Open Source [Forked]
    taguch1
    taguch1 2014/10/03
  • 「みんなジョブズに騙されている」増井俊之教授が進歩の止まったコンピュータのUIを問い直す【TechLIONレポ】 - エンジニアtype | 転職type

    モノづくりをテーマに行われた『TechLION vol.18』。登壇者は左から寺薗淳也氏、瀬尾浩二郎氏、増井俊之氏 コンピュータはこの30年、まったく進歩していない――。 有名エンジニアによるトークライブの場としてすっかりおなじみになった『TechLION』の壇上で、慶應大学環境情報学部の増井俊之教授は業界の現状を憂えた。 2014年9月に開催された『vol.18』のテーマは「モノづくり」。小惑星探査機『はやぶさ』プロジェクトチームの一員としても知られる会津大の寺薗淳也准教授、面白法人カヤックから独立しフリーのエンジニア/クリエイティブ・ディレクターとして活躍中の瀬尾浩二郎氏とともに、UI研究の第一人者、増井教授は登壇した。 時々刻々と性能が上がっているように見えるコンピュータ(編集部注:増井氏の発言では「計算機」)が、30年にわたってまったく進歩していないと指摘する増井氏の真意とは? 『

    「みんなジョブズに騙されている」増井俊之教授が進歩の止まったコンピュータのUIを問い直す【TechLIONレポ】 - エンジニアtype | 転職type
    taguch1
    taguch1 2014/10/03